1use std::path::Path;
2
3use crate::error::DkpResult;
4
5/// A parsed OKF concept file: YAML frontmatter + Markdown body.
6#[derive(Debug, Clone)]
7pub struct OkfConcept {
8    pub path: std::path::PathBuf,
9    pub frontmatter: serde_yaml::Value,
10    pub body: String,
11}
12
13/// Parse a single OKF concept file (Markdown with YAML frontmatter).
14pub fn parse_concept(path: &Path) -> DkpResult<OkfConcept> {
15    let content = std::fs::read_to_string(path)?;
16
17    if let Some(stripped) = content.strip_prefix("---\n")
18        && let Some(end) = stripped.find("\n---\n")
19    {
20        let yaml_str = &stripped[..end];
21        let body = stripped[end + 5..].to_string();
22        let frontmatter: serde_yaml::Value =
23            serde_yaml::from_str(yaml_str).map_err(|e| crate::error::DkpError::OkfFrontmatter {
24                file: path.display().to_string(),
25                reason: e.to_string(),
26            })?;
27        return Ok(OkfConcept {
28            path: path.to_path_buf(),
29            frontmatter,
30            body,
31        });
32    }
33
34    Err(crate::error::DkpError::OkfFrontmatter {
35        file: path.display().to_string(),
36        reason: "missing YAML frontmatter delimiters".to_string(),
37    })
38}
39
40/// Walk an OKF layer directory and parse all concept files.
41pub fn parse_okf_dir(okf_dir: &Path) -> DkpResult<Vec<OkfConcept>> {
42    let mut concepts = Vec::new();
43    fn walk(dir: &Path, out: &mut Vec<OkfConcept>) -> crate::error::DkpResult<()> {
44        for entry in std::fs::read_dir(dir)? {
45            let path = entry?.path();
46            if path.is_dir() {
47                walk(&path, out)?;
48            } else if path.extension().is_some_and(|e| e == "md") {
49                out.push(parse_concept(&path)?);
50            }
51        }
52        Ok(())
53    }
54    walk(okf_dir, &mut concepts)?;
55    Ok(concepts)
56}

58#[cfg(test)]
59mod tests {
60    use super::*;
61    use tempfile::TempDir;
62
63    #[test]
64    fn parse_concept_valid_frontmatter() {
65        let tmp = TempDir::new().unwrap();
66        let path = tmp.path().join("concept.md");
67        std::fs::write(
68            &path,
69            "---\ntype: concept\nname: Test\n---\nBody content.\n",
70        )
71        .unwrap();
72
73        let concept = parse_concept(&path).unwrap();
74        assert_eq!(
75            concept.frontmatter.get("type").and_then(|v| v.as_str()),
76            Some("concept")
77        );
78        assert_eq!(concept.body, "Body content.\n");
79    }
80
81    #[test]
82    fn parse_concept_missing_delimiters_errors() {
83        let tmp = TempDir::new().unwrap();
84        let path = tmp.path().join("concept.md");
85        std::fs::write(&path, "No frontmatter here.\n").unwrap();
86
87        let err = parse_concept(&path).unwrap_err();
88        assert!(matches!(err, crate::error::DkpError::OkfFrontmatter { .. }));
89    }
90
91    #[test]
92    fn parse_concept_invalid_yaml_errors() {
93        let tmp = TempDir::new().unwrap();
94        let path = tmp.path().join("concept.md");
95        std::fs::write(&path, "---\n[unclosed\n---\nBody.\n").unwrap();
96
97        let err = parse_concept(&path).unwrap_err();
98        assert!(matches!(err, crate::error::DkpError::OkfFrontmatter { .. }));
99    }
100
101    #[test]
102    fn parse_okf_dir_walks_nested_directories() {
103        let tmp = TempDir::new().unwrap();
104        let sub = tmp.path().join("nested");
105        std::fs::create_dir_all(&sub).unwrap();
106        std::fs::write(tmp.path().join("top.md"), "---\ntype: concept\n---\nTop.\n").unwrap();
107        std::fs::write(sub.join("child.md"), "---\ntype: concept\n---\nChild.\n").unwrap();
108        std::fs::write(tmp.path().join("not-markdown.txt"), "ignored").unwrap();
109
110        let concepts = parse_okf_dir(tmp.path()).unwrap();
111        assert_eq!(concepts.len(), 2);
112    }
113
114    #[test]
115    fn parse_okf_dir_empty_returns_empty_vec() {
116        let tmp = TempDir::new().unwrap();
117        let concepts = parse_okf_dir(tmp.path()).unwrap();
118        assert!(concepts.is_empty());
119    }
120}
